This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
This is a Principal Product Engineering role focused on Money Infrastructure at Replit. You’ll work on the financial backbone that powers how Replit earns money, how builders earn money, and how Agents transact. This role sits at the intersection of engineering, product, and the business. The systems you build directly impact revenue, trust, and some of the most critical user journeys on the platform.
Job Responsibility:
Lead the design, architecture, and implementation of Replit’s core money infrastructure, spanning pricing, billing, payments, and monetization
Own and scale the global order-to-cash foundation supporting credit-based subscriptions, usage-based billing, marketplaces, in-app payments, and commerce for Agents
Enable rapid pricing and packaging experimentation across the company by building flexible abstractions and APIs for new SKUs, plans, and monetization models
Build high-converting, localized payment experiences across geographies — thinking globally while enabling users to pay locally
Power builder monetization by creating payment rails for apps, Agents, subscriptions, and new monetization primitives
Partner closely on data specifications with finance, accounting, and data teams to produce accurate, auditable, and reliable financial data
Collaborate with external monetization and payments partners (e.g. billing platforms, payment processors) to accelerate execution
Create monitoring, observability, and feedback systems to proactively detect issues, resolve failures, and optimize performance across financial flows
Requirements:
8+ years of professional software engineering experience, with strong backend expertise
Hands-on experience building or operating at least one of the following: Subscription or recurring billing platforms
Usage-based or metered billing systems
Payment processing platforms
SaaS taxation or compliance systems
Tokenization or credits-based systems
Strong system design skills, especially for high-reliability, high-correctness domains like money
Comfort working autonomously in ambiguous, fast-moving environments with high business impact
Excellent debugging and problem-solving skills, including handling complex billing edge cases and failure modes
Experience building customer-facing billing or payments interfaces that simplify complex pricing models
Nice to have:
Experience with usage-based billing platforms like Orb, Metronome, or Stripe Billing
Experience building coupons, referral programs, credits, or other monetization growth systems
Experience working on marketplaces, fintech integrations, or multi-party payment flows
Prior work on globally distributed payment systems with localization and compliance considerations